Medicaid and Value-Based Care

How value-based care works in the country's largest coverage program: managed care contracting, state directed payments, Section 1115 waivers, health-related social needs, and how state agencies buy value.

By the end of this course, you will be able to:

  • Explain how Medicaid's federal-state structure and open-ended match shape its value-based options
  • Describe how a state uses its managed care contracts to drive value through health plans
  • Distinguish state directed payments that raise rates from those that reward value
  • Identify which authority a given social-needs benefit relies on, and how stable that authority is
  • Assess why churn, low payment rates, and safety-net dependence change value-based design in Medicaid
